Let me know if you have any questions/issues. That's the rough process, but like I said, it's really not as bad as you think once you get it templated out. Then, use JAMF Now to deploy the app, and if possible use JAMF Now to lock the iPad into Single App mode. Also, for the hell of it, just grab the unlock token. I'd recommend making a blueprint for this.

Jamf now apple configurator 2 install#

Use Configurator to install any iOS updates, mass enroll in JAMF Now, and supervise the iPads. Don't make the mistake of staking them though, as that stack will get really hot and some of the iPads will shutdown automatically. Has to be powered to keep the iPads charged. You'll want to get a powered USB hub, maybe like an 8 port from Anker or something, so that you can plug in multiple at a time. We did a similar project for some conference room displays and none of those iPads were in DEP. Once you get the hang of it, it's really not as bad as you're anticipating.
